How do I properly prepare and seed an area to ensure it grows? Let’s go over the basics on that today.

Step 1: Preparing the Area
First you’ll want to prepare the area that you want to seed. If you have dead
grass there or debris in the area you’ll want to rake that free to open up the area. You’ll
want to cultivate and loosen up the soil some. Typically can be done with a metal tip
rake or another tool. You just want to loosen up compacted soil and clear any dead
debris from the area that can block sunlight and nutrients.
Step 2:
Next you’ll want to bring in some nutrient rich soil. Something that is high in
nutrients and even better if starter fertilizer is already mixed in. Depending on the area
and how much is needed you’ll want to sprinkle some of that into the soil.

Step 3:
Third you’ll want to mix in some premium seed with no weed matter in it. I would
not skimp out on this step and get cheap seed. If you’re already spending the time and
money to do all the other work put down a quality product. If you soil doesn’t already
have some starter fertilizer you can put some of that into the soil as well.
Step 4:
We at RD’s Total Lawn like to use straw overtop the area. This will protect from
birds and other animals. It will help hold moisture in keeping the area wet for
germination. It also let’s people know to avoid the area of foot traffic and running
equipment over it which can disrupt the germination process. If you wanted some more

Step 5:
Last but certainly not least step as it is one of the most important is to water it.
The area needs to stay moist as to not dry out. If it dries out in the middle of germination
the grass could die out and never grow. You’ll want to water 2 times daily for the first 10
days or so until you see germination coming up. Once the turf gets established you’ll
want to consider some type of fertilizer and weed control program to keep it healthy.

Final points
Timing is always key with lawncare. Seeding especially you have two main times
of year to do this with best results. Spring and Fall. Fall is much more ideal but it can be
done in the spring just need to be mindful of some of the risks of spring seeding.
